What they do

A Manufacturing Project Engineer manages the manufacturing process from conception to completion. Supervises manufacturing teams, evaluates proposals and documentation, plans the whole manufacturing process and oversees the implementation to completion. Is the primary technical point of contact for the project.

Full Job Description Job Description:
The Manufacturing Engineer/Process Design Engineer's primary responsibility is to design and/or evaluate customer submitted artwork to ensure it is compliant with the machinery prerequisites and meets standards and performance requirements. Create, review, and approves designs, drawings, specifications, etc. of existing or new technology or applications. Provides expert judgment and analysis for the design, development, and implementation of technical products and systems. Recommends alterations to development and design to improve quality of products and/or procedures. The Manufacturing/Process Design Engineer handles complex aspects of design process and has a hand in the manufacturing process. Performs a variety of tasks. Leads and directs the work of others. A wide degree of creativity and latitude is expected. The Manufacturing Engineer/Process Design Engineer is also responsible for the promotion of awareness of all applicable regulatory requirements. Primary Responsibilities Manage assigned engineering and customer projects from initial request through production. Review customer drawings and specifications for manufacturability. Create and modify SolidWorks models and AutoCAD drawings. Develop manufacturing processes, work instructions, tooling, and fixtures. Work directly with Production and machine operators to troubleshoot manufacturing issues. Support Engineering, Quality, Sales, and Production with technical questions. Communicate with customers and suppliers as needed. Assist with root cause investigations and corrective actions. Support new product introductions, samples, and process validation. Maintain accurate project and engineering documentation. Participate in continuous improvement activities. Required Qualifications Bachelor's degree in Mechanical Engineering, Manufacturing Engineering, Industrial Engineering, Engineering Technology, or another closely related engineering discipline. SolidWorks. AutoCAD. Ability to read and interpret manufacturing drawings. Basic GD&T knowledge. Microsoft Excel and Microsoft Office. Strong problem-solving and analytical skills. Basic understanding of engineering materials and manufacturing processes. Strong communication skills. Willingness to work directly with Production and learn different manufacturing processes. Preferred Qualifications Manufacturing or project engineering experience. Lean Manufacturing / Continuous Improvement. Six Sigma. Epicor or other ERP/MRP systems. Root Cause Analysis. FMEA, PPAP, IQ/OQ/PQ, and 5S. Experience with waterjet, laser cutting, CNC routing, die cutting, adhesive converting, foam converting, laminating, or similar manufacturing processes.
